Overview of the Book of James
The book of James is a practical guide for living a Christian life, focusing on themes such as patience, wisdom, and faith. It is a collection of wisdom sayings and teachings that provide guidance on how to live a virtuous life. The book is composed of five chapters, each addressing a specific aspect of the Christian walk, including trials, temptations, and relationships. The authorship of the book is attributed to James, who is believed to be the brother of Jesus or James the Great. The book of James is known for its straightforward and simple language, making it accessible to readers of all backgrounds and levels of understanding. It is a valuable resource for those seeking to deepen their faith and live a life that is pleasing to God, with its teachings and principles remaining relevant today.

James the Brother of Jesus
James the Brother of Jesus is believed by scholars to be the son of Joseph and Mary, making him the half-brother of Jesus. He is considered a significant figure in the early Christian church, and his writings are still studied today. The James study guide explores his life and teachings, including his role as the leader of the church in Jerusalem. According to historical accounts, James the Brother of Jesus was martyred around 63 AD, and his legacy has endured for centuries.
